2 · Overlooking Metal Allergies
It’s not just about how a ring looks. Some metals can irritate your skin-especially white gold that contains nickel or cobalt under a thin rhodium plating. That irritation doesn’t show up right away, but when it does, it’s not fun.
Quick Fix: Go hypoallergenic. We usually recommend:
- Platinum: Durable, skin-safe, and luxe without shouting for attention.
- 18K Yellow Gold: A timeless classic with fewer alloy additives.
- Nickel-Free White Gold: Still that crisp white look-without the risk.

3 · Not Thinking About Your Daily Life
Let’s be honest your wedding band’s not just for the big day photos. It has to survive real life.
Are you:
- Rock climbing on weekends?
- Snapping surgical gloves on during your ER shift?
- Lugging groceries or toddlers or both?
Delicate bands or high-set stones aren’t built for all that action.
Quick Fix: Choose something that hugs your finger and holds up under pressure. Flush-fit or bezel settings are ideal for active lifestyles. 4 · Underestimating Maintenance (It's a Thing)
Even the toughest rings need a little love over time. White gold needs rhodium replating every 12–18 months to stay bright. And tiny prongs can loosen, especially if your ring’s your constant companion.

FAQ: Smart Wedding Band Shopping
When should we start shopping for wedding bands?
Aim for at least 3-4 months ahead of your wedding date. Customizations, resizing, or special orders can take time-and rushing it is never worth it.
Do our wedding bands have to match?

What's a realistic budget?
It varies. You can find classic bands under $500, but custom designs with gemstones or intricate details can go into the thousands. Most of our couples spend $1,200–$3,500 per band.
Can we resize later?
Usually, yes-especially with plain bands. Eternity rings or vintage details can be trickier. We’ll walk you through what’s future-proof.
Which metals do best in Phoenix heat?
Platinum and 18K yellow gold both hold up beautifully. White gold works too-just expect to replate it periodically to maintain that icy shine.
